  • Page 2 INTRODUCTION DESCRIPTION Designed to meet the needs of all open-ceiling applications, the Pure Resonance Audio PD6 6.5" indoor/outdoor pendant speaker is weather-resistant, high powered, and easy to install. The PD6 uses an acoustically matched 6.5" and 1" tweeter to maximize performance while minimizing the overall footprint of the speaker.

  • Page 5 BASIC SPEAKER INSTALLATION - 70 VOLT SYSTEMS AND APPLICATIONS Figure 1. Figure 2. Correct Speaker Wiring Incorrect Speaker Wiring SPEAKER OUTPUT 70V 100V SPEAKER OUTPUT 70V 100V Be careful not to cross wires when installing your speakers. Wiring should always be negative to negative and positive to positive (Figure 2.
